TRIO (Transplant Recipients International Organization)

International. 43 chapters. Founded 1983. Works to improve the quality of life of transplant candidates, recipients, donors and their families. TRIO serves its members in the areas of donor awareness, support, education and advocacy. Annual conference, bi-monthly newsletter, monthly membership update, support network and chapter development assistance. Offers information online on finding local chapters.

Second Wind Lung Transplant Association, Inc.

International network. Founded 1995. Developed by transplant patients. Opportunity for persons who have undergone, or who will undergo, lung transplants to share their stories on a web page. Newsletter available.
